Equipment Engineering Director jobs in Springdale, AR

Equipment Engineering Director directs equipment engineering activities within an organization. Plans and develops policies and procedures for designing, developing and implementing equipment. Being an Equipment Engineering Director ensures all equipment engineering projects, initiatives, and processes comply with established policies and objectives. Typically requires a bachelor's degree. Additionally, Equipment Engineering Director typically reports to top engineering management. The Equipment Engineering Director manages a departmental sub-function within a broader departmental function. Creates functional strategies and specific objectives for the sub-function and develops budgets/policies/procedures to support the functional infrastructure. Deep knowledge of the managed sub-function and solid knowledge of the overall departmental function. To be an Equipment Engineering Director typically requires 5+ years of managerial experience.     JOB OVERVIEW: Supervise the implementation of all property and equipment preventive maintenance and repairs, monitor life safety systems and utilities and assist in the administration of the department in compliance with all corporate/franchise standards and local, state, and national codes and regulations to protect assets, guests and employees.

    ESSENTIAL JOB FUNCTIONS:
    • Interview, hire, train, recommend performance evaluations, resolve problems, provide open communication and recommend discipline and/or termination when appropriate.
    • Troubleshoot and repair malfunctions in mechanical or electrical systems (e.g., HVAC, plumbing) and other equipment throughout the hotel.
    • Perform preventative maintenance assignments on a scheduled basis.
    • Respond in a courteous manner to all guest questions, complaints, and or requests to ensure strong guest satisfaction.
    • Communicate with hotel department heads to become aware of maintenance needs and ensure timely response to internal requests.
    • Service the hotel's pool, including adjusting chemicals and cleaning filters; completing maintenance request forms and record logs.
    • Maintain the building exterior and "curb appeal" (e.g., snow removal, lawn care, painting, and gardening).
    • Maintain franchise standards and follow-up on inspection deficiencies.
    • Coordinate compliance of service contracts.
    • Implements and maintains Crescent’s preventative maintenance program.
    • Implement and maintain Crescent’s room care programs.
    • Implement and maintain Crescent’s engineering department minimum standards.
    • Assist General Manager with annual Capital Plan development.
    • Actively participate in Crescent’s Safety Plan and energy improvements.
    • Communicate both verbally and in writing to provide clear directions to staff.
    • Comply with attendance rules and be available to work on a regular basis.
    • Perform any other job-related duties as assigned.

     REQUIRED SKILLS AND ABILITIES:

     Must have the ability to communicate in English.  Self-starting personality with an even disposition.   Maintain a professional appearance and manner at all times.  Can communicate well with guests.  Must be willing to “pitch-in” and help co- workers with their job duties and be a team player.  Must be able to recognize potential safety hazards and security problems in the hotel and act upon each accordingly.  Be skilled in several areas such as HVAC, electrical, carpentry, drywalling, painting, plumbing, roofing, and landscaping.  Must be able to troubleshoot and repair routine mechanical and electrical malfunctions in hotel systems and equipment.  Must be willing and able to be responsive to complaints about maintenance.

According to the United States Census Bureau, the city has a total area of 108.9 square miles (282 km2), of which, 108.3 square miles (280 km2) of it is land and 0.7 square miles (1.8 km2) of it, or 0.62%, is water. The city limits extend north into southern Benton County. Springdale is bordered by the cities of Cave Springs, Lowell, and Bethel Heights to the north, by Elm Springs and Tontitown to the west, and by Johnson and Fayetteville to the south.
